Output 76ab71af684d7d5c383dc6f3a8fa397bce81b7fa63722c554d30e951f89e2e29:6

value
118413
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17859fff87cf8b7fc16b6fe4791deab97e006b4b OP_EQUAL
address
33qPYPB5VA2yb8BsBJPi83HUMDcGkdr7hs
transaction
76ab71af684d7d5c383dc6f3a8fa397bce81b7fa63722c554d30e951f89e2e29
spent
true